PRO-INTERNET SENATOR KILLED IN PLANE CRASH


MINNEAPOLIS, Minnesota (ADMS) - One of the most vocal critics of the
Communications Deceny Act, and other draconian Internet bills of the 1990s,
Paul Wellstone, has been killed in an airplane crash. Wellstone, his wife,
and daughter were also killed in the aircraft.
The plane, with 8 people on board, went down in freezing rain in
Eveleth, about 280 north of Minneapolis. There were no survivors of the
crash. Wellstone's daughter Marcia, and wife Sheila were among the 8 people
killed on board the plane.
Wellstone was well known for being a vocal critic in the Senate of the
now-defunct Communications Decency Act. He also received the scorn of the
Religious Right, because of his vocal criticism of the bill. He was one of
the 16 senators who stood up to the American Nazi Party (a.k.a. the Religious
Right), and voted against the bill on 8th June 1994. Wellstone also voted
against other Net-censorship bills, such as the Hyde-Blyley Act, and the
Digital Millenium Copyright Act.
Wellstone was first elected to the United States Senate in 1990, beating
incumbent Republican Rudy Boschwitz. He was also a political science
professor who earned his PhD from the University of North Carolina, in 1969.

TOTOMIANA/MARININ WIN SKATE AMERICA PAIRS TITLE


SPOKANE, Washington (AAMS) - The first medals have been awarded at Skate
America. Totomiama and Marinin have the gold medal at Skate America. They
continue the Russian domiance in the Pairs event.
The Russian couple were the only ones who got what you could really call
high technical marks in the long program. The new computerised scoring system
gave them marks ranging from 5.5 to 5.7 for the techical part of the program.
Despite questionable judging in the past, the Russians have the best pairs
skating program in the world. It is built on the Russian tradition of classical
ballet dancing.
A surprising seconfd place finish is the Canadian team of Langlois and
Archetto, who were given scores of 5.4 to 5.7 by the computer. Canadian pairs
skating has been given a boost, since 2001, when Sale and Pelletier won
Canada's first pairs world title, since 1962. Canada seems to be the real
challenger to the Russian juggernaut in pairs skating.
The Chinese team of Pang and Tong finished 3rd here at Skate America. Last
season, they captured China's first EVER world title in ANY figure skating
discipline. The Chinese skating program is a work in progress. China though
